Transaction 27e57575ac3e0a8fa3edceb985e8d406e557482723d0485fc7583fdeb3f0423e
1 Input
1 Output
-
27e57575ac3e0a8fa3edceb985e8d406e557482723d0485fc7583fdeb3f0423e:0
- value
- 8106022
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ddf8f95060976b4d044b76aaf82a80f43f275da2 OP_EQUAL
- address
- 3MvhWwsgy9EvrgxMBm4gzsXgDMYm2mvisE